Innovation Energy Storage Technology Forum
Renesas EP (Embedded Processing) New Energy Layout
The 2025 Innovation Energy Storage Technology Forum was co-hosted by Electronic Enthusiasts Network and the Munich Shanghai Electronics Exhibition. Renesas Embedded Processor Division Senior Expert Yao Li delivered an impressive speech titled “Renesas EP’s New Energy Layout,” focusing on products such as RA8T1, RA2A2, RZ/V2H, and RZ/G3E, and how these products can help make energy power applications smarter, more efficient, and safer.

Renesas Embedded Processor Division Senior Expert Yao Li
Renesas EP’s advantages in new energy applications include: leading processes and a rich product line, high reliability and stable supply chains, strong partnerships and solution provider relationships, and endpoint AI capabilities. The RA8T1, with its high computing power, large memory, and rich analog and peripheral integration, can efficiently achieve three-phase inverter control, meeting the complex demands of motor and power control; the RA2A2 is mainly used for 1-phase, 3-phase, and DC metering in energy management applications; the RZ/V2H is primarily used for high-performance visual AI, including industrial cameras, robots, AGVs, smart factories, and smart retail; the RZ/G3E features a 4-core high computing power and rich peripherals, suitable for mid-to-high-end HMI, IoT, and industrial automation applications. In this speech, Yao Li also showcased solutions based on these products, such as human detection visual AI applications, which, using Helium, achieved a 3.6 times increase in inference speed compared to Cortex-M7, with inference performance reaching 13.6 fps.
In addition, Renesas provides critical hardware support for energy storage applications, such as the RA6T2 and RA8T2 products for inverter control, the RA6M5 and RA8T2 products for system control, and the RA2L1 and RA2L2 products for battery pack management, as well as the RA6M5, RA8M1 for system master control, and RZ/G2, RA8D1 for overall control. These products feature high performance, low power consumption, high integration, and rich communication interfaces, meeting the diverse needs of different stages in energy storage systems. In the critical inverter arc detection design for energy storage, Renesas utilizes advanced AI technology to effectively identify and detect arc signals in energy storage inverters, enhancing system safety and reliability.
International Automotive Electronics Technology Innovation Forum
Renesas High-Performance MCU
Supporting the Development of Future New Generation Automotive Electronic and Electrical Architectures
The 2025 (3rd) International Automotive Electronics Technology Innovation Forum was co-hosted by the Shanghai Transportation Electronics Industry Association, the Shanghai Pudong Automotive Electronics Innovation and Intelligent Industry Alliance, and Munich Exhibition (Shanghai) Co., Ltd. At the meeting, Renesas Electronics Automotive MCU Market Director Zhu Xiaofeng delivered a keynote speech on “Renesas High-Performance MCU Supporting the Development of Future New Generation Automotive Electronic and Electrical Architectures,” introducing the important role of Renesas’s advanced products in the transformation of automotive electronic and electrical architectures.

Renesas Electronics Automotive MCU Market Director Zhu Xiaofeng
As the trend of software-defined vehicles and electrification deeply integrates, automotive electronic and electrical architectures are evolving from distributed to centralized integration. In this process, high computing power, low power consumption, and functional safety have become core requirements. The Renesas RH850/U2x series MCUs and R-Car SoC solutions integrate Ethernet TSN, CAN-XL, and other interfaces, support ISO26262 ASIL-D safety level, with a software reuse rate of 95%, suitable for domain controller scenarios, helping automotive companies shorten development cycles. For intelligent and energy-efficient balance, the product layout based on 28nm technology can enhance computing power while optimizing power consumption, balancing performance and cost. Zhu Xiaofeng stated that future automotive-grade semiconductors will evolve towards an ecosystem of “hardware standardization and software modularization.” Renesas will continue to empower the global automotive intelligence transformation and promote sustainable development in the automotive industry through technological innovation and open collaboration.
International Motor Drive Technology Forum
Sensorless FOC Motor Solutions Across All Speed Ranges
The 2025 International Motor Drive Technology Forum was hosted by Techsugar and Munich Exhibition (Shanghai) Co., Ltd. Renesas Embedded Processor Division Senior Manager Liu Tao delivered a keynote speech on “Sensorless FOC Motor Solutions Across All Speed Ranges,” introducing Renesas’s rich products and solutions in the field of motor control.

Renesas Embedded Processor Division Senior Manager Liu Tao
Liu Tao first introduced Renesas’s diverse motor MCU product line, covering RL78, RA, RX, RISC-V, and other product families. These MCU products have different operating frequencies, core architectures, and storage capacities, meeting the needs of various application scenarios. Among them, the RA6T2, as a star product, adopts a 40nm high-performance process, equipped with a Cortex M33 core with FPU, achieving a high performance of 962.4 CoreMark @ 240MHz, supporting various communication interfaces, analog peripherals, and system functions, and also features functional safety and information security characteristics. In the speech, Liu Tao detailed Renesas’s sensorless FOC motor solution across all speed ranges. This solution aims to help customers easily develop sensorless control functions for IPM motors across all speed ranges, maximizing torque performance. It estimates motor position using a pulse voltage injection method during startup/low speed, achieving smooth motor drive from startup to high speed within a ±10° position estimation error, reducing the risk of losing steps.
